区块链研习社万钻俱乐部区块链

区块链的区分

2018-11-19  本文已影响13人  木木大木木
区块链的区分

很多并不是深入了解这方面的,在区块链刚出现时候会出现疑惑,但其实数据库并不能说是区块链。

区块链其实是一种数字账本,并且它是在区块的数据结构上对信息加以存储,而在数据库中是通过表格格式来储存信息。虽然两者都为存储信息,但是设计的理念是完全不同的,并且目标也是不同的。

1,数据库

能够用来制作各类商业、金融、企业管理等的一种报告模式所需要的数据,像政府管理部门也会使用数据库来记录一些大型的数据。

数据库是从各个数据的不同开始分类的,并提供了最基础的获取信息以及存储的作用。那些基础的数据以表格的形式呈现出来,存储在数据的行列中。表格中所包含的有不同的范围,用来定义不同的记录,存储数据是它的属性,每个范围内所包括的有列与行,代表的也就是存储的记录。

并且数据库是可以被管理员进行修改、管理、控制,他们可以重新创建、更改或者是删除任何一条在数据中的记录。同时管理员还可以优化数据库中的性能及大小,数据库的模式越大往往会在更新信息时遇到一些情况,这就需要管理员及时来优化。数据库是需要足够的控制能力,传统数据库是以中心化的形式来保证系统的安全性、可靠性。有的数据会在私人的网络下进行,同时还会有大公司的防火墙来巩固。

其他的数据库是在云服务的基础上,仍然需要管理员的控制。

2,区块链

一提起区块链很多人都会联想到比特币,区块链其实是在2009年诞生的,比特币是在它基础上的第一个系统。在这个比特币的系统中,区块链会在大小一样的区块中存储信息,每个区块中还会再包含有之前的数据与信息,从而提供加密的安全性。

现在我们所看到的区块链用的是去中心化的分布式网络,去中心化也就表明网络中的各个节点都会得到保存及备份。如果这些区块一旦经过链化,那所有的信息都会变成不可更改和透明性。

在区块链中能保证它的安全,本质上就是去中心化,如果有人想要子区块链上修改一些信息,首先需要其他人来帮助验证。如此这样就会造成新的链分割出来,并且只有达到比主链还长才会有效。

就像比特币中就有在区块链中能保证它的安全,本质上就是去中心化,如果有人想要子区块链上修改一些信息,首先需要其他人来帮助验证。如此这样就会造成新的链分割出来,并且只有达到比主链还长才会有效。

就像比特币中就有几千个节点,所以要是有人进行欺诈,就得改变网络中的所有节点,同时也需要大量的计算和电力,这是不容易做到的。这就像是一种保证,没人可以欺骗任何人,这也是区块链不可更改的原因。

具有稳定性的数据库,是比较适合企业网络的,传统的数据库会通过授权来保证数据的加密性。而区块链的需求是建立在信任和透明上,使用区块链技术可以拥有新级别的系统,也可以帮助更多不同系统进行验证。

上一篇下一篇

猜你喜欢

热点阅读